Keywords Studios, the video game services mainstay, is facing a line-up of disputes with unions after it laid off employees at one of its Canadian offices. The Dublin-headquartered company recently laid off 13 employees after BioWare, a division of Electronic Arts behind the Dragon Age series, ended its contract with the company. Keywords’ games testers in Edmonton had voted last year to join a Canadian workers union in a bid to negotiate deals on pay, benefits, and remote working.
